This grand *chappra* is a perfect example of traditional event decor for a housewarming. Woven from coconut leaves and adorned with marigold garlands, it provides an impressive and auspicious welcome right at the entrance of the home.
Creating a divine atmosphere at home for a pooja ceremony is all about the details. This bridal pooja setup combines traditional brass lamps, beautiful flower arrangements, and a pearl curtain backdrop to create a peaceful and sacred setting for rituals.
Here is a closer look at the craftsmanship involved in a traditional *chappra*. The roof is made of intricately woven leaves, while the front is decorated with beautiful red and white floral hangings, blending natural materials with classic floral art.
Even a simple *chappra* can make a house feel festive and ready for a *Gruha Pravesh*. This entrance features banana plants, a symbol of prosperity, and colorful marigold garlands, creating a warm, traditional welcome for family and friends.
This is another style of a traditional welcome gate, or *chappra*, constructed with woven coconut leaves. The structure is decorated with garlands of white flowers and red roses, perfect for a housewarming ceremony or other traditional functions.

When I plan your Gruha Pravesh, I focus on the logistics that matter most on the day. My team ensures the traditional chappra entrance is sturdy and doesn't obstruct your main gate, and we use fresh flowers that stay vibrant throughout the entire ceremony, even in the humidity.
A Gruha Pravesh (housewarming) is a major milestone, and I want to make sure your focus stays on the prayers and your family, not on managing vendors. I handle the entire setup—from the woven coconut leaf chappra at your entrance to the serene floral backdrops for your pooja unit.
For many families, getting the timing right with fresh flowers and banana stems is the hardest part. I coordinate the delivery and installation to ensure everything is perfect right before your auspicious time (muhurta).
My approach covers the essentials:
- Traditional Entrances: I construct chappras using fresh coconut leaves and marigold garlands, designed to look authentic and welcoming.
- Pooja Backdrops: I create calm, spiritual spaces using fresh jasmine, sevanti, and brass accents that complement your home's interior, whether it is a villa or an apartment.
- Logistics: I take care of the site visit, transport, and next-day clearance. You won't be left with debris or the stress of cleaning up after the rituals are done.
